CH1 6EZ is a primarily residential postcode in Two Mills, Cheshire West and Chester. It was first introduced in January 1980.
The most common council tax bands are F and E.
Residential buildings are primarily detached. Domestic properties are mostly houses and bungalows.
Estimated residential property values, based on historical transactions and adjusted for inflation, range from £24,160 to £890,331 with an average of £349,414.
Residential buildings were typically constructed before 1900 and between 1950 and 1966.
None of the residential properties sold since 1995 have been new builds or newly converted.
Domestic properties are predominantly owner occupied.
The most common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) ratings are F, G and E.
Commercial rateable values range from £3,050 to £67,500 with an average of £35,275. The most common recorded business types are Car Showroom and Cafe.
In the 2011 census, there were 29 people resident in CH1 6EZ, of which 14 were male and 15 were female. This also includes overnight visitors at domestic properties, and residents of non-domestic properties such as hotels, prisons and halls of residence.
CH1 6EZ is in the Chester travel to work area. NHS services are provided by the Western Cheshire Primary Care Trust.
CH1 6EZ is approximately 43m (141ft) above sea level.
